#!/bin/bash # Submission script for GridEngine (GE). Each job will # be executed via the jobScript.sh # This jobScript supports up to 7 parameters. Edit # the user specific part of the script according to # your program. # # Input to the script is a filelist with 1 file per line. # For each file a job is started. With the parameter # nFilesPerJob a comma separated filelist will be # generated and handed to the job script. This feature # is usefull when running many small jobs. Each # job has its own logfile. All needed directories for the # logfiles will be created if non existing. # # IMPORTANT: the hera/prometheus cluster jobs will only # see the /hera file system. All needed scripts, programs # and parameters have to be located on /hera or the job # will crash. This script syncs your working dir to the submission # dir on /hera . Make sure your scripts use the submission dir! # Software should be taken from /cvmfs/hades.gsi.de/install/ # # job log files will be named like inputfiles.
